Paver porch repair services involve restoring and maintaining the integrity of existing paver entrances, walkways, and porch areas. These services typically include replacing broken or cracked pavers, realigning uneven surfaces, and fixing underlying issues that cause shifting or settling.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the paver installation, identify areas of damage or movement, and perform necessary repairs to improve both the safety and appearance of the porch. Proper repair work can help extend the lifespan of paver surfaces and prevent more costly repairs in the future.

Common problems addressed by paver porch repair include cracked or loose pavers, uneven surfaces, and drainage issues. Over time, weather conditions, ground movement, or poor initial installation can cause pavers to crack, shift, or become uneven. These issues not only detract from the visual appeal but can also create tripping hazards or make the surface difficult to navigate. Repair services help resolve these problems by resetting or replacing affected pavers, filling in gaps, and ensuring proper drainage to prevent water pooling and further damage.

The overview below groups typical Paver Porch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or fixes like crack filling or patching typ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this range involve simple repairs that local contractors can handle efficiently. Larger, more complex repairs can push costs higher but remain within a moderate range.

Surface Resurfacing - resurfacing a paver porch often falls between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on the size and condition of the area. Many projects in this category are mid-sized, with fewer reaching the upper end of the cost spectrum for extensive surface work.

Full Replacement - replacing an entire paver porch typically costs from $4,000 to $8,000 for many standard-sized projects. Larger or more intricate installations can exceed this range, but most jobs fall within the mid to upper tiers based on scope and materials used.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- extensive or highly detailed paver porch renovations can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more. These projects are less common and often involve premium materials or complex designs that increase overall cost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of paver porch repairs do local contractors handle? Local service providers can address issues such as cracked or uneven pavers, loose stones, and damaged mortar joints to restore the integrity of a paver porch.

How can I tell if my paver porch needs repair? Signs like shifting pavers, visible cracks, or drainage problems may indicate that repairs are needed to maintain safety and appearance.

What are common causes of paver porch damage? Damage often results from ground movement, poor installation, weather conditions, or heavy foot traffic over time.

Are there different repair options for various types of paver materials? Yes, local contractors can recommend specific repair methods tailored to the material, whether concrete, brick, or natural stone.

How do local service providers ensure quality repair work? They typically use industry-standard techniques and materials suited to the specific paver type to help ensure durable and lasting repairs.
